Precautions for
Correct Use
- A user-specified file is created on RAM. If the power of EQ100 is turned off, the file will be lost.
- User-specified files are deleted from the oldest one if the internal RAM is full. The RAM
capacity is for 1 day in case of 1-minute collecting for 500 channels. Data must be fetched
within 24 hours if you fetch data with FTP from outside.
- If data of 1-minute collecting cycle is included, the output interval must be 12 hours or less.
・ The User-Specified file is mandatory for FTP use. The file is not saved in the SD card.
・ The User-Specified files cannot be imported to the database of EQ server. For import, use
the Internal System files.

Specify a cycle to create the files.
If an interval is over one hour, specify a
reference hour for an hour to output.
For example, if a reference hour is 2:00
and an output interval is 6 hours, output
is done at 2:00, 8:00, 14:00, and 20:00.
